Pulmonary edema

when fluid fills interstitial lung tissue and alveoli, tissue density increases, may lead to congestive heart failure (additive= increase technique)
TB- tuberculosis

- Infection by a mycobacteria causes the inflammatory response, which results in an increase in fluid in the lungs. If the mycobacteria were inhaled, it generally begins as a localized lesion (usually upper lobes), which can spread to a more advanced stage. If the infection reaches the lungs by the bloodstream, it has a more diffuse spread (miliary TB). Increased tissue density results in both advanced and miliary TB. (Additive= increase technique)
Aortic aneurysm

A large dilatation of the aorta will result in increased thickness of the affected part. (Additive= increase technique)
Ascites

Fluid accumulation within the peritoneal cavity causes an increase in tissue thickness.The free fluid has a unique "ground glass" appearance radiographically. (additive= increase technique)
